The Stettler Library Board is a charitable organization based in Stettler, Alberta, classified by the CRA under public amenities. It appears on the charity register the way hospitals, universities, and other publicly funded bodies do — to issue tax receipts — rather than as a donation-driven charity in the usual sense. In its f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, it reported $561K in revenue and $559K in expenditures.
Its funding that year was roughly 87% from government. Government funding is the majority of its budget. In 2024, 3 other registered charities reported granting it a combined $100.
Compared with 686 public-amenity institutions of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 3% of peers. Its fundraising cost per donated dollar was lower than 80% of that peer group. Its highest-paid positions fell in the $40,000–79,999 range (3 positions in that band). The charity reported 4 permanent full-time positions.

The ledger, 2020–2024
| Year | Revenue | Spending | Programs | Fundraising | Gifts out | Net assets |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| $561K | $559K | $50K | $913 | — | $118K |
| 2023 | $521K | $507K | $36K | $770 | — | $153K |
| 2022 | $489K | $499K | $29K | $1,488 | — | $127K |
| 2021 | $485K | $467K | $36K | $2,137 | — | $142K |
| 2020 | $478K | $463K | $31K | $2,385 | — | $125K |
Revenue printed in red where the year ran a deficit. Fiscal years by period end.
